For those too lazy to watch all the vids, quick synopsis: now when you grow and feed fish the little aquatic fellows need to get rid of the excess nitrogen they take up with the food ... however, fish cannot piss like us to get rid of nitrogen, instead they breathe out ammonia into the water. Now ammonia is toxic to the fish so you gotta get rid of it otherwise they will suffocate. This is done by running the water through a biofilter where bacteria turn ammonia into nitrate ... and nitrate in the end is fertilizer for plants so you can next run the water through a hydroponics culture to grow vegetables. The plants remove then nitrogen from the water and you can run it back into the fish tank. Quite a nice system, can be sized from smol backyard operation up to something that could provide food to a whole village.

Why do equilibrium flow happen ?
It happens because the water needed to start the siphon is the same or more then that require to sustain a continuous flow.

How do we stop equilibrium flow ?
To stop this equilibrium flow few things needed to be done:
Ensuring the difference between water flowing in to make a siphon and water needed to sustain a continuous flow large.
Ensuring water flowing out of the siphon at the end of cycle (residual flow) will still be strong enough to pull in air causing the break.
How do we achieve this ?

We have to make a siphon to start with less amount of water flow in, to that of the same size basic siphon.
Make a siphon with strong residual flow.
Which would make the difference above large enough to ensure no continuous flow is maintain.

I anticipate a community of 15 families with a full dorm would consume 1800 broilers per year. That's three of these giant bastards. Layers should be kept in smaller tractors with no more than 30 hens and a solitary Chad rooster. Scaling that up requires more roosters, and if you pen them in together they'll spend all their time fighting or killing your hens.

Roosters are strange, and tend to pick favorites for servicing, just like people. If there are multiple roosters around, and they notice one of them choosing a favorite, they'll also focus on that hen to the point where they will spend all their time fucking it to death. You'll go out one day and the poor hen will have all the feathers on the back of its neck and back torn off, and by the next day it will be covered in blood. By day three ... death by snu snu. Multiple roosters can work in a yard and coop scenario, but not in tractors. Ever.

I srsly like the aquaponics idea! Good vids btw! Tilapia might be good choice for simple system as they eat all kinds of (waste) plant material and are quite tolerant to changing water conditions. Think keeping a comfy temperature for them is the biggest hurdle depending local climate.
